Pay a visit to the Ozark region of Mid-America and the Kansas City Southern’s Heavener Subdivision. Running from Pittsburg, Kansas to Heavener, Oklahoma, this is an interesting route for the train watcher. With a sawtooth profile, dramatic elevation changes, and a twisty-curvy railroad, the KCS crosses the Ozark’s Springfield Plateau and the Boston Mountains.

The KCS offers an interesting variety of motive power including ES44AC’s and SD70ACe’s to GP40-3’s plus run-through locomotives of BNSF and Union Pacific.
